About the Role

This position works with all hotel departments to ensure safety and maintenance standards are

kept high and is responsible for responding to assignments from the Chief Engineer/Facilities

Manager and as needed by the Manager on Duty. The nature of these requests is normally

routine and preventative. Circumstances may dictate emergency response.

What You’ll Do

  • Remain current on applicable building codes and governmental regulations.

  • Respond to all radio call within ten minutes, if not possible, notify the manager or

Manager on Duty.

  • Participate as the team leader in the event of a fire alarm.

  • Maintain and repair mechanical and electrical equipment.

  • Attend to all calls / requirements for guest rooms.

  • Maintain building, furniture and fixtures, perform repairs of a plumbing, electrical,

mechanical, welding or general repair nature to all hotel areas and all outlets, including

the spa, retail and public pool spaces.

  • Maintenance assignments include checking, replacing and repairing items such as light

bulbs, ballasts, filters, window screens, greasing, belts, motor bearings, headboards,

small wallpaper tears, some painting, faucets, sinks, AHU filters, door closers, laundry

and kitchen equipment repairs, etc.

  • Daily checks on all boilers and records readings and problems in the official logbook.

  • Check and maintain pool chemicals and equipment and record all readings every 4

hours.

  • Keep updated on fire panel and computerized equipment.

  • Check and maintain grease traps on a regular basis.

  • Perform other job-related duties as assigned.

What We’re Looking For

  • Minimum 4th class power engineering certificate.

  • Minimum 2 years’ experience working with boiler and chiller systems.

  • Valid Occupational First Aid would be an asset (preferably Level III).

  • Working knowledge of electrical, plumbing, HVAC, bearings, pumps, and being able to

carry out repairs on all items.

  • Experienced with building safety systems.

  • Pool operators’ certificate would be an asset (willing to be obtain).

  • Mechanically inclined and able to repair kitchen appliances, laundry equipment, motor

bearings etc.…

  • Strong prioritization and organizational skills.

  • Works well under pressure, remains calm, has a positive attitude and is an active team

player.

  • Flexible to a changing/rotating schedule, day and night shifts.
